CACM logo

Research highlights

Goldilocks: A Race-Aware Java Runtime

[article image]
Credit: R. John Wright Dolls Inc.

GOLDILOCKS is a Java runtime that monitors program executions and throws a DataRaceException when a data race is about to occur. This prevents racy accesses from taking place, and allows race conditions to be handled before they cause errors.

The full text of this article is premium content!

sign in

get access

Create a Web Account

If you are already an ACM member, Communications subscriber, or Digital Library subscriber, please set up a web account to access premium content on this site.

Join the ACM

Become a member to view this article and take full advantage of ACM's outstanding computing information resources, networking opportunities, and other benefits.

Subscribe to Communications of the ACM

Get full access to 50+ years of CACM content and receive the print version of the magazine monthly.

Tools For Readers

Bookmark and Share
Default Font Size Large Font Size X-Large Font Size Text Size

Related ACM Resources

Conferences:

Courses:

  • The ITIL Foundation Certification v3.0 - The ITIL Foundation certification course is the first in a portfolio of ITIL certification Courses. The purpose of the course is to certify that the …

In The Digital Library


About Communications | Join ACM External Link | Renew External Link | Subscribe External Link | Sign In | For Authors | For Advertisers External Link | Privacy | Site Map | Help | Contact Us | Mobile Site

Copyright © 2012 by the ACM. All rights reserved.